What is a Niche Market?
“A niche market is segmented according to the wants and needs of a very narrow consumer group. This special market, which large enterprises do not want to enter or see, has a structure with limited consumers. It's like a tailor who only produces golf clothing, selling oversized and undersized clothing…”

What is Niche Marketing?
“Niche marketing is a marketing strategy that focuses solely on a unique target market. Rather than marketing to anyone who might benefit from a product or service, this strategy focuses on just one group (a niche market) or demographic of potential customers who will benefit most from the offerings.”
Why a Niche Market?
Going through a niche market is a practical and effective business strategy. This market is the solution for companies that want to stand out and earn money on the internet surely. By targeting a market in niche markets, a business will have few competitors.
This is possible because a niche market includes specialized markets. You can find a specific niche, and specific products, which are intended for a particular segment only.
Since the targets of these products are limited and specific, it is rare to find a company that offers them. The fewer proposals there are, the fewer competitors there will be. Apart from that, a niche market makes it possible to start a project at low costs since the products are limited compared to the products of a generalist market.
It's kind of like a focus strategy. The company will focus on a specific product and monopolize the start-up funds for that product. This then allows other efforts and funds to be focused on other tasks. Otherwise, a niche market also makes it easy to retain and satisfy customers.

What are the benefits of the Niche Market?
What makes niche marketing attractive is that you only offer products or services tailored to the needs of a group of potential consumers.
1. Less competition.
Generally, there is less budget and fewer companies to compete in a niche market. However, as a niche market becomes more attractive and achieves a certain sustainable market volume, more players can join the search to take advantage of opportunities.
2. More effect.
Since it is a small market, every communication activity you do will directly affect your target audience. You can find niche communities on social media sites, eg. For example on Facebook groups or LinkedIn. The good news is that building your brand and building brand awareness within a community is relatively easy compared to mass communication.
With less competition, there will be fewer messages to confuse target consumers. Thus, the impact of your products or services will be quite high.
3. You develop your expertise quickly.
Listening to niche communities, interacting on social media, and researching topics related to a niche gradually lead to your specialization. Over time, you can position yourself as an authority figure within the niche community as you use your knowledge to improve your marketing.
4. Expansion opportunities.
After determining your income and profits, you can consider expanding and transitioning to other niches. Many businesses grow this way.

What are the advantages of Niche Market Products?
Selling niche market products will have some advantages for you. We can list these advantages as follows:
1. Less competition.
Because they are niche products, these products have a smaller market and therefore the competition for these products is very low.
Of course, although this situation of competition varies according to the sector, focusing on areas that can create volume but have no competition yet will help you run your business in a low competitive environment.
2. It is less costly.
You can do these works at lower costs due to the niche products and the number of products to be sold on the site. Because you will reduce warehouse costs, product management,t, and inventory costs, you need lower budgets to finance your business.
3. You can make your voice heard better.
Less competition and reduced e-commerce site management costs allow you to easily allocate a budget for marketing and advertising studies. Having the opportunity to make your voice heard better, especially in small competitive sectors, also makes it easier for you to reach the customer masses.
4. Search engine optimization becomes easier.
While selling niche market products, you will also have an advantage in SEO work. Especially in sectors where competition is low, you can start to drive traffic to your site organically, as it becomes easier for you to rank higher in Google search queries.

What should you do to research Niche Market Products?
When doing niche market product research, you will need to focus on 5 main topics. These topics are as follows:
1. Product Research
When doing niche market research, you especially need to find the right products. For this reason, it should be your first study to undertake product research. In this process, it is important to discover the problems of consumers and to search for product alternatives that can solve their problems
In addition to solving these problems, you should analyze the money consumers will pay for such a product, what they want from the product, and their expectations from the product in your market research.
2. SEO Analysis.
While researching niche market products, you should also research the search queries made on these products on search engines. In addition to products, you also need to do sectoral keyword research.
When doing niche market product research, you should analyze the monthly search volumes of these products. You need to find product groups with high search volume but not yet competitive. In product groups with low search volume, your investments may go in vain, as it will be very difficult to create a market to sell the products.
By identifying your keywords and then researching other keywords related to these keywords, you can start to see how much you can develop your market and potentially the growth possibilities of this market.

3. Competitor Analysis.
When doing niche market research, you should also research competing companies that sell the products or alternatives you are researching.
By measuring the competition in the market, you should also analyze how many of these companies reaching the sector. If the market is dominated by these competitors, it can be challenging for you to enter this sector.
To change the minds of consumers and stand out from the competition, you need to make serious investments, which does not always mean that your return on investment will keep you at a profitable level.
4. Product Supply.
One of the studies you need to do in the research of niche market products will be to search for product supply processes and alternative suppliers. Sticking to a single supplier will not be the right approach.
If you have a problem with this supplier or if this supplier is not able to meet the product demands, you will also be at a loss.
For this reason, you should have more than one supplier and be prepared for possible problems. For this reason, it is important to research your suppliers regarding the products you plan to sell.
5. Product Analysis.
Finally, you need to analyze your products. After you find your products with low SEO and market competition, you should also research how consumers will view those products and whether they will demand them.
However, by calculating the stock and shipping costs of the product, you should determine how the sale of these products will cost you. Since these costs will also affect the pricing of your products, you should make the best of your cost calculations.
It is important to meet the expectations of consumers in product pricing and to have pricing that they are willing to pay.
Too high a price will drive consumers away, and too low a price will reduce your profit margin. For this reason, your pricing is also an important issue in this regard.
